Western University's Psychiatry Residency Program offers a comprehensive 5-year training experience in London and Windsor, Ontario. The program provides a balanced educational approach with a favorable faculty-to-resident ratio, allowing for direct supervision and exposure to the full breadth of psychiatric practice. Residents benefit from a flexible curriculum, strong research opportunities, and a supportive learning environment.

Program Overview

Teaching Philosophy

The program emphasizes competency-based medical education with progressive independence, focusing on comprehensive training that prepares residents for diverse psychiatric practice settings through supervised clinical experiences, didactic teaching, and longitudinal learning.

Training Setting

Training occurs across multiple urban academic medical centers in London, Ontario, including London Health Sciences Centre, St. Joseph's Health Care, and specialized facilities like the Child and Parent Resource Institute.

Research Opportunities

Residents participate in research methodology training, with active research programs in mood and anxiety disorders, stress-related disorders, and child-adolescent psychiatry.
